Default Just installed jimfab motor mounts

I just recently installed the jimfab motor mounts on my 93 civic coupe with a b18c swap. I must say these things are are the S*&T. They help with the wheel hop problem i was have and also improved my drivablilty with the kaaz lsd (can barely feel the clicking at low speed turns). These mounts are a must have.
